buf_recursed(9) freebsd man page | unix.com

Man Page: buf_recursed

Operating Environment: freebsd

Section: 9

BUF_RECURSED(9) 					   BSD Kernel Developer's Manual					   BUF_RECURSED(9)

NAME
BUF_RECURSED -- checks if the lock linked to the buffer is recursed
SYNOPSIS
#include <sys/param.h> #include <sys/systm.h> #include <sys/uio.h> #include <sys/bio.h> #include <sys/buf.h> int BUF_RECURSED(struct buf *bp);
DESCRIPTION
The BUF_RECURSED() function checks if the lock linked to the given buffer is recursed and returns 1 if the condition is true, 0 otherwise. Its argument is: bp The buffer linked to the lock. See lockmgr_recursed(9) for details.
SEE ALSO
buf(9), BUF_LOCK(9), BUF_UNLOCK(9), lockmgr(9)
AUTHORS
This manual page was written by Attilio Rao <attilio@FreeBSD.org>.
BSD
January 22, 2008 BSD
Related Man Pages
physio(9) - debian
buf_timelock(9) - freebsd
physio(9) - centos
physio(9) - linux
physio(9) - suse
Similar Topics in the Unix Linux Community
FreeBSD Kernel Internals, Dr. Marshall Kirk McKusick
Scripts without shebang
Reason for no directory creation date
Is it safe to install x86 Solaris 10 U6 after installed-Linux-and-FreeBSD?